软件开发英文俗称(软件开发英文俗称什么)
Software Development
Software development, also known as computer programming, is the process of creating, designing, testing, and maintaining software applications. It involves writing code in various programming languages to instruct a computer to perform specific tasks or functions. Software developers use a variety of tools and technologies to develop software that meets the needs of users and organizations.
The software development process typically starts with gathering requirements from stakeholders, such as clients or end-users. This involves understanding the problem that the software is intended to solve and identifying the features and functionality that the software should have. Once the requirements are defined, developers create a design for the software, outlining the structure and flow of the application.
Next, developers write code to implement the design. This involves using programming languages like Java, Python, C++, or JavaScript to create the logic and algorithms that power the software. Developers also use libraries, frameworks, and other tools to streamline the development process and improve the efficiency and quality of the code.
Testing is a crucial part of the software development process. Developers conduct various tests to ensure that the software works as intended and is free of bugs and errors. This may involve writing automated tests, manual testing, and user acceptance testing to validate that the software meets the requirements and functions correctly.
Once the software is developed and tested, it is deployed to production environments for users to access and use. Developers also provide ongoing maintenance and support for the software, addressing any issues or bugs that arise and making updates and improvements as needed.
Software development is a collaborative process that often involves working in teams. Developers may work with designers, project managers, quality assurance testers, and other stakeholders to create software that meets the needs of users and delivers value to organizations. Effective communication, problem-solving skills, and attention to detail are essential for success in software development.
In conclusion, software development is a complex and dynamic field that plays a critical role in the digital world. It encompasses a wide range of activities, from planning and designing software to writing code, testing, and deploying applications. Software developers use their skills and expertise to create innovative solutions that drive technological advancements and improve the way we work, communicate, and live.
还没有评论,来说两句吧...